For the most part, criminal offenses committed by active duty service members are prosecuted before the Courts-Martial of the United States.  A military court martial is a legal procedure that seeks to obtain justice while also promoting military discipline.  The court martial process is highly complex, and these cases will always warrant aggressive representation from an experienced military attorney.
